Activity VI (Review), , Question 6., , Prepare a review of the films which influenced you the most., (Hints: theme, screenplay, cast and credit, music,, cinematography, etc.), , Answer:, , Bhargavinilayam, , An enthusiastic and talented novelist (Madhu) comes to stay in a, desolate mansion named Bhargavi Nilayam. The novelist and, his servant Cheriya Pareekkanni (Adoor Bhasi) experience the, presence of a strange entity here. They come to know from the, local people that it is a haunted house. The story is that it is, haunted by the ghost of the daughter of the previous owner. The, novelist and his servant encounter strange happenings here — the, gramophone plays on its own, objects move around. The, novelist finds some old letters written to Bhargavi (Vijaya, Nirmala) by her lover Sasikumar (Prem Nazir). It is believed, that the ghost of Bhargavi now haupts this house., , The letters give some indication about their love affair and their, tragic deaths. The novelist decides to probe the matter. He starts, writing the story of Bhargavi. The information gathered from the, local people and the hints in the letters help him in his writing., The story develops. Bhargavi falls in love with her neighbour, Sasikumar who is a talented poet and singer. Bharagavi’s, father’s nephew, Nanukuttan (P. J. Antony) is also in love with, Bhargavi. But Bhargavi hates Nanukuttan who is a bad man., Nanukuttan tries all nasty tricks to separate the lovers. He kills

Sasikumar. Bharagavi becomes furious when she comes to know, of her lover’s murder. In a scuffle Nanukuttan pushes Bhargavi, into a well, killing her. Nanukuttan spreads the news that, Bhargavi had committed suicide., , The novelist reads out the story to the ghost who by now has, become quite compassionate with him. Nanukuttan overhears, the story. He fears that once the story is published the truth, behind the death of Bhargavi and Sasikumar will be out. He, attacks the novelist and a fight ensues. During the fight both, Nanukuttan and the novelist reach the well in which Bharagavi, was drowned. While trying to push the novelist into the well,, Nanukuttan loses his balance. He falls into the well and is killed,, while the novelist escapes. The novelist then prays for the peace, of Bhargavi’s soul and the movie ends with the laugh of, Bhargavi., , Bhargavinilayam means The House of Bhargavi’. It is a 1964, Malayalam horror-romance film written by Vaikom Muhammed, Basheer and directed by A. Vincent. The film stars Prem Nazir,, Madhu and Viiava Nirmala in the lead roles. Its story,, screenplay and dialogues are written by Vaikom Muhammad, Basheer. It was the directorial debut of noted cinematographer, A. Vincent. The film is especially noted for its music by M. S., Baburaj. It was the first horror film in Malayalam and was one, of the biggest hit films of all time.
